**Q: Why did my nightly backfill not run?**

KestrelQueue schedules backfills in dependency order. If an upstream table in the Marrowlake warehouse is stale, your job is held, not failed — check the hold queue before filing anything. Holds auto-release once freshness checks pass. Manual release requires sign-off from the Dataflow rotation. Retries cap at three per night. Full scheduling rules, hold semantics, and the escalation matrix are on the internal page.

runbook for tafof-yawif: https://confluence.tolvaqsys.internal/display/display/browse/pages/7be3

### Escalation — Sweepster Orphan Cleanup

If Sweepster flags more than 500 orphaned volumes in one pass, don't panic — it's usually a stale tag filter, not an actual leak. Pause the sweep with `sweepster halt`, snapshot the candidate list, and ping the infra channel. If the list includes anything tagged `release-locked`, that's a hard stop: nothing gets deleted until the Calderon Cloud platform leads sign off. For sign-off requests or anything you can't untangle within an hour, email the sweeper owners.

alerts address for kafog-haweg: wendor.ulaael@zemvarworks.internal

Hey Marisol — handing off the ProctorLine exam queue before I'm out. Plugin authors keep asking how retries work: failed proctoring sessions requeue twice, then land in the dead-letter bucket that Tobin's dashboard watches. Nothing fancy. If a plugin needs to tweak timeouts or concurrency, point them at the sandbox tier first, not prod. Everything a plugin can override lives in the config below.

config for kajef-hahof:
[ulamir]
port = 5672
region = central-1
host = ulamir.lumicsys.corp
timeout_ms = 2000
retries = 3